Genghis Khan and the Making of the Modern World

Editor's Pick
"Nazis targeted NJ in the ‘30s. Newark fought back."
"As a New Jersey native, armchair historian, and someone who works in Newark every day, I probably should’ve known the inspiring story about the Minutemen in the 1930s. Pro-Nazi groups tried to recruit American immigrants, and enjoyed early, sinister success. A faction of Jewish mobsters, ex-boxers, students, and factory workers defended Jewish interests in Newark, led for a time by Nat Arno, the Minuteman of the title. Greg Donahue, a talented documentary storyteller, and Jonathan Davis—one of my favorite narrators—bring forgotten history to life with nuance and a hint of contemporary urgency. Who knew? Now we all do!"
